PASTORAL LEADER’S NOTES Dear Parishioners,
Today we gather on this Palm Sunday weekend to begin HOLY WEEK — a week we enter with reverence, a week of demands that we embrace with delight, a week to celebrate its many rituals with all the care, devotion and energy they deserve.
To celebrate Holy Week is to celebrate who we have become through Christ’s paschal mystery—His life, death and resurrection. It is a time for us to suspend regular business and give our fullest attention to ALL the details that make up this holiest of weeks. Make plans today to bring your family and join us for these Holy Week rituals starting at
7:00pm in Omro on Holy Thursday with our Eucharistic procession to Winneconne,
continuing through Good Friday at 1:00pm in Winneconne and 6:00pm in Omro and culminating with the
Easter Vigil in Winneconne on Saturday at 8:00pm and Mass at 7:30am and 9:00am in Omro and 11:00am in Winneconne
on Easter Sunday!
The keeping of these days is what makes us Christian and even more, what makes us CHURCH. Do things differently at home next week. Fast, wait, be quiet and pray. If we do these Holy Week days well, little by little we grow in holiness and are transformed into the very likeness of Jesus Christ. My hope is that we can walk these days together and make this
our best Holy Week ever!
Sr. Pam

STEWARDSHIP—A WAY OF LIFE! Adopt A Family- Fish Fry Style
THANK YOU to all who made this outreach a great success! To those who delivered meals
To those who donated financially so all meals delivered were paid for and For those who helped put the meals together for delivery!
To follow is a summary of this Lenten outreach: $360 in anonymous donations was received
13 Delivers - some did one fish fry, others did two, and yet others delivered meals for all three fish fries! 47 meals were delivered to the homebound and care givers that live with them.
Stewardship is a way of life where both the receiver and giver receive God’s grace and goodness.
Here is some feedback received that demonstrates this truth:
“I wanted to let you know that it (delivery) went well. In an amazing "God moment" we knew the couple from sitting close to them on some Saturday evening Masses. In fact, we shared a pew with her and I was going to ask her where her husband has been because we haven't seen him in a while. It was the highlight of our family's day!"

Dear Parents: The end of the 2017-2018 Faith Formation year is coming quickly. Thank you for sharing your children with us and committing to helping your children grow in faith. The church is not a substitute for the committed love, daily sacrifice, and hard work of parents in caring for their children. But we are here to support families in the very important vocation of parenthood. As we move into the season of Easter, consider how you will “rise again” and help your children gain a better understanding of how much God loves them….through your actions, words and prayer. LOVE is key, HOPE helps us begin again when we fall short, and FAITH is what keeps us moving towards the Kingdom of God. Throughout Easter continue to grow in virtue because virtuous living brings more peace and joy into our lives. Will it be patience, honesty, grace, compassion, forgiveness, self-sacrifice? What ever it is, invite God to walk with you and may the peace of God, which transcends all understanding be with you (Philippians 4:7).
In Christ, Rose, Heidi and Sadie Your Faith Formation Team
